How To Work AI Assistant

Step 1: Voice Input

The user interacts with the AI assistant by speaking voice commands or queries. The assistant’s primary mode of communication is through voice recognition technology. It converts the user’s spoken words into digital data that the system can process.

Step 2: Speech Recognition

The assistant analyzes the digital data to recognize and transcribe the user’s speech accurately. This process involves complex algorithms that can distinguish and interpret different words and phrases.

Step 3: Natural Language Processing (NLP)

Once the user’s speech is transcribed, the assistant utilizes NLP techniques to understand the meaning behind the words. NLP enables the assistant to interpret the user’s intent, identify relevant keywords, and extract essential information from the input.

Step 4: Information Retrieval

Based on the user’s input and the extracted information, the AI assistant searches for relevant data. It may have access to vast knowledge databases or connect to the internet to retrieve real-time information. The assistant uses this data to generate appropriate responses or provide relevant recommendations.

Step 5: Machine Learning (ML)

To improve its performance over time, the AI assistant employs ML algorithms. It learns from user interactions, user feedback, and data analysis to enhance its understanding, accuracy, and ability to cater to individual preferences. ML allows the assistant to adapt and personalize its responses based on user behavior.

Step 6: Response Generation

With the gathered information and the assistance of ML algorithms, the AI assistant formulates a response. It could be a spoken reply, a text-based message, or an action performed on behalf of the user.

Step 7: User Interaction

The assistant communicates the generated response to the user, either through voice or text. The user can then continue the conversation, ask further questions, or provide feedback, initiating a continuous interaction loop.

Lack of Contextual Understanding

One of the primary drawbacks of AI assistants lies in their limited contextual understanding. While they excel at performing specific tasks and providing pre-programmed responses, they often struggle to comprehend complex queries or engage in meaningful conversations. AI assistants heavily rely on pattern recognition and predefined algorithms, making it challenging for them to grasp the subtleties of human language, emotions, and context. Consequently, users may experience frustration when their assistant fails to comprehend their intentions accurately.

Limited Personalization

AI assistants often lack personalization, which can be a significant drawback for users seeking tailored experiences. While they may remember certain preferences or past interactions, their ability to adapt and evolve based on individual users’ unique needs is limited. The lack of personalization can result in generic recommendations, irrelevant suggestions, or repetitive interactions, failing to provide a truly personalized and enriching user experience.

Privacy and Data Security Concerns

As AI assistants become more integrated into our lives, concerns regarding privacy and data security arise. AI assistants typically collect and process vast amounts of personal data to improve their performance and offer customized services. However, this raises questions about how this data is stored, used, and protected. Instances of data breaches or unauthorized access to user information can lead to severe consequences, including identity theft or the misuse of sensitive data. Users must remain vigilant and cautious about the information they share with AI assistants.

Lack of Emotional Intelligence

AI assistants lack emotional intelligence, which hinders their ability to comprehend and respond appropriately to human emotions. While they may mimic empathy through pre-programmed responses, they do not genuinely understand the emotions behind a user’s query or request. This limitation can be particularly evident during situations that require empathy, support, or nuanced emotional understanding. As a result, users may feel disconnected or dissatisfied with the assistant’s responses, especially when dealing with sensitive matters.

Dependency and Reduction in Human Interaction

While AI assistants are designed to make our lives easier, their increasing prevalence can lead to a reduction in meaningful human interaction. Over-reliance on AI assistants for various tasks, such as scheduling appointments, answering queries, or even engaging in casual conversation, may contribute to a decline in interpersonal skills and social interactions. This drawback poses challenges to the development of social bonds and may result in a lack of genuine human connection.

Inability to Handle Complex Tasks

Despite their impressive capabilities, AI assistants still struggle with handling complex tasks that require deep understanding, creativity, or critical thinking. While they excel at executing routine or predefined tasks, they lack the cognitive abilities to navigate ambiguous situations or generate novel solutions. This limitation becomes evident in domains that demand human intuition, judgment, or domain-specific expertise.
